Former 'Bachelorette' JoJo Fletcher reveals her biggest beauty regret on the show

  • JoJo Fletcher reveals that her makeup and brow game has drastically improved since her days on "The Bachelor."
  • She fixed her brows by learning not to overfill or over-line them.
  • Fletcher is a long time user of St. Ives's scrubs, but is always up for trying new products when it comes to taking care of her skin.
  • Her basic beauty products include face mist, moisturizer, and ChapStick.

With the gorgeous ladies of "The Bachelor" and "The Bachelorette" regularly looking on point, from their enviable swimwear to their stunning hair and makeup (which, by the way, is NOT provided!), it’s hard to imagine them ever making a beauty misstep. Turns out, they’ve suffered through their fair share of beauty blunders too, as JoJo Fletcher was all too happy to share with "People."

According to the 26-year-old, her makeup and brow game has drastically improved since her stint on Ben Higgins’s season of "The Bachelor."“It’s night and day how much better I’ve gotten at putting on my own makeup…If you would have seen my eyebrows, they would have been a mess, I never paid attention to them,” she confessed. She also got real about how she fixed the problem, saying, “… Just knowing not to overfill them or overline them, and not making them too dark [is something I’ve learned].”

If your eyebrows are already on fleek (jealous!) but you’re struggling with your skincare routine, Fletcher has some tips there too. She’s a longtime user of St. Ives’s scrubs (“I think it was the first scrub I ever used. It was also Jordan’s, which is really funny,”), but says she’s always trying new products. “I think some people are scared to try a bunch of products, but fortunately my skin isn’t very sensitive, so I experiment with everything.”

Still, her overall routine stays pretty much the same: “I’m always washing my face in the morning, I do a toner, serum. Sunscreen is really important. And then just moisturize.”

As for her beauty bag staples, Fletcher says, “I love a good face mist, a moisturizer, ChapStick. The basics so I don’t feel like I’m… going to completely dry out because I travel a lot.”
